Petropars Signals Readiness to Enter Iraq's Energy Market

  2025 April 18
  AUTHOR :farzad panahnezhad
During a high-level meeting between the oil ministers of Iran and Iraq, Petropars Group announced its readiness to actively participate in Iraq’s oil and gas sector, leveraging its technical and operational expertise.

According to Petropars’ Public Relations and International Affairs Office, Dr. Hamidreza Saghafi, CEO of the group, emphasized Petropars’ full capabilities in large-scale energy projects and called for the establishment of joint technical and expert meetings between the two neighboring countries.

In a presentation to Iranian and Iraqi ministers and their delegations, Dr. Saghafi outlined Petropars’ extensive achievements, highlighting over 673 million man-hours of operational work and more than 305,000 meters of drilling onshore and offshore, with a total project value exceeding $1.33 billion.

“These figures are a testament to our technical and managerial strength in implementing mega oil and gas projects,” he said.

 

Dr. Saghafi underlined Petropars’ solid track record in upstream activities, stating that the company is prepared to contribute its expertise to Iraq’s energy development in alignment with the strategic objectives of Iran’s Ministry of Petroleum.

As a result of the meeting, both sides agreed to hold joint expert sessions in the near future to explore avenues of cooperation.

It is noteworthy that Iranian Oil Minister Mohsen Paknejad visited Iraq in late April at the invitation of his Iraqi counterpart, Hayyan Abdulghani. The visit, which resulted in four cooperation agreements between Iranian and Iraqi energy firms, reflects Iran’s active and strategic oil diplomacy in the region.
